Accutane normally takes about 12 weeks to clear skin, so you were lucky last time. 20% of Accutane patients (including me) need to take Accutane a second or third time, so don't worry. If it worked before, there is no reason for it not to work this time.
Cetaphil is a great choice for cleansing and moisturising skin whilst on Accutane. Try Vichy Dermablend make-up to cover imperfections while you wait for your medicine to work.
I know it is frustrating having to take it a second time, but Accutane is your best hope of a long term remission from acne.
